自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(19)
  • 收藏
  • 关注

转载 如何在网页中动态显示当前时间

如何在网页中动态显示当前日期和时间解决思路:顺着上一例的思路和方法,只需要设置一个定时器,每秒更新一下输出的时间。具体步骤:方法一:取到各个部分后作字符串连接代码示例:document.write("id=time>") //输出显示时间日期的容器setInterval(function(){with(new Date)time.innerText=

2016-07-24 15:06:38 2330

原创 折线分割平面

题意:一条折线可以将平面分割成两部分,两条可以分割为7部分。那么n条呢?思路:参考大神的思路,如果n条直线可以将平面分为1+1+2+……n,如果每次增加两条相互平行的直线,当第n次添加时,第2n-1条直线和第2n条直线都各能增加2*(n-1)+1 个平面。所以第n次添加增加的面数是2[2(n-1) + 1 个。因此,总面数应该是1 + 4n(n+1)/2 - 2n 

2016-05-11 16:32:41 175

原创 bitset

题意:十进制转化为二进制思路:数字每个位存到数组里,倒叙输出ac代码:#includeusing namespace std;void f(int x){    int a[30];    int i=0,r;    while(x)    {        r=x%2;        x=x/2;        a[i]=r;     

2016-05-10 12:27:14 159

原创 骨牌铺方格

题意:在2×n的一个长方形方格中,用一个1× 2的骨牌铺满方格,输入n ,输出铺放方案的总数。Input输入数据由多行组成,每行包含一个整数n,表示该测试实例的长方形方格的规格是2×n (0Output对于每个测试实例,请输出铺放方案的总数,每个实例的输出占一行。Sample Input132Sample Output

2016-05-03 10:22:49 166

原创 超级楼梯

题意:有一楼梯共M级,刚开始时你在第一级,若每次只能跨上一级或二级,要走上第M级,共有多少种走法?Input输入数据首先包含一个整数N,表示测试实例的个数,然后是N行数据,每行包含一个整数M(1Output对于每个测试实例,请输出不同走法的数量Sample Input223Sample Output12思路

2016-05-03 10:06:27 147

转载 C/C++时间函数使用方法

看不懂,但肯定有用,留着!  来自:http://www.cnblogs.com/xd502djj/archive/2010/09/23/1833361.html     Coordinated Universal Time(UTC):协调世界时,又称为世界标准时间,也就是大家所熟知的格林威治标准时间(Greenwich Mean Time,GMT)。比如,中国内地的时间与UT

2016-04-28 10:50:28 171

原创 2016SDAU课程练习三1004

题目大意:由2,3,5,7组成的数给定5842个,输入n,求第n个数。Sample Input1234111213212223100100058420Sample OutputThe 1st humble number is 1.The 2nd humble number is 2.The 3rd humble number

2016-04-27 15:09:01 258

原创 2016SDAU课程练习三1003

题目大意:求最大递增子序列。Sample Input3 1 3 24 1 2 3 44 3 3 2 10Sample Output4103AC代码:#include#includeusing namespace std;int n;int a[1000],b[1000];int dp(int *a

2016-04-27 09:07:49 224

原创 2016SDAU课程练习三1002

题目大意:输出两个字符串,求公共子序列长度。Sample Inputabcfbc abfcabprogramming contest abcd mnpSample Output420AC代码:#include#include#include#include#includeusing namespac

2016-04-26 15:09:19 211

原创 2016SDAU课程练习三1001

题目题意:最长上升子序列问题。Sample Input25 6 -1 5 4 -77 0 6 -1 1 -6 7 -5Sample OutputCase 1:14 1 4Case 2:7 1 6解题思路:以每个数作为最后一个数考虑,递归找出最大的sum。AC代码:#include using namespace

2016-04-26 14:23:34 210

原创 2016SDAU课程练习二1002

大体题意: F(x) = 6 * x^7+8*x^6+7*x^3+5*x^2-y*x (0 给出y,求x取0--100之间某数时f的最小值。Sample Input2100200Sample Output-74.4291-178.8534解题思路及形成过程:先把y当做常数求导,求导之后的f ’ ==0时的x带入f 就是最小值。对

2016-03-29 10:10:50 241

原创 2016SDAU课程练习一1017

简单题意:以下给定的箱子尺寸高都一样,长和宽不一样,有1*1,2*2,3*3,4*4,5*5,6*6,六种型号。最后都装入6*6*h的箱子里。分别输入6种型号箱子的个数,求最少用几个箱子打包。解题思路及形成过程:4*4,5*5,6*6,的有几个就需要几个箱子,2*2和1*1的插空,比较难处理的是3*3的。可以4个一起,也可以插入2*2的和1*1的。感想:哦两天多 积极性下降了哎

2016-03-22 20:14:00 224

原创 2016SDAU课程练习一1012

简单题意:给定n,m,m=a的n次方,求a。解题思路及形成过程:用pow感想:我挺害怕这种题,我怕复杂繁琐的步骤,还好没有超范围。ac代码:#include#includeusing namespace std;int main(){    int a;    double n,m;    while(cin>>n>>m)    {

2016-03-19 22:55:51 191

原创 2016SDAU课程练习一1005

简单题意: 给出5种币值的钱的数量,让找出一定钱数的最少和最多币值数量的方案的币值数是多少。解题思路及形成过程:刚开始想最少数量时勉强想得出来,但最多数时就吃力了。还是网上有一种很好的方法:因为我们要求的是花的最多数量纸币,所以就是要保证手上的纸币数量最少。于是第二次运算时用手里钱的总和减去要一定钱数。感想:天哪,自己跟自己说好一天一题简直头大,就在刚才的23:59提交了a

2016-03-19 00:01:15 303

原创 2016SDAU课程练习一1016

简单题意:FJ在调查他的奶牛的平均产奶量,他想知道奶牛的产奶量的最中间数,即:一半的奶牛的产奶量比这个中间数多(或者少),另外的一半则刚好相反.解题思路及形成过程:排序,求中间值。感想:好吧之前说有一道题用了最短时间,其实这个才是。。。。AC代码:#include#includeusing namespace std;int main(){    i

2016-03-17 17:19:41 151

原创 2016SDAU课程练习一1001

简单题意:切木头。给出木头的长度和重量,当切的下一根的木头和重量都大于前一个时不用调整工具,否则调整一次一分钟。第一次切需要一分钟的准备时间。解题思路及形成过程:刚开始的时候我是按照1004的方法做的,找到比前一组长度或重量小的就+1,但这并不是最优解,所以一直WA。AC代码:#include #include #include #inclu

2016-03-17 15:59:52 264

原创 2016SDAU课程练习一1006

简单题意:只有一个电梯。上楼需要六分钟,下楼需要四分钟,每一层停留五分钟。输入n组数据,按照特定的顺序上下楼,求总共需要的时间。解题思路及形成过程:虽然放在贪心算法的专题,但是显然用

2016-03-16 08:11:56 189

原创 2016SDAU课程练习一1000

简单题意:有400个房间:,需要从一间房间搬桌子到另一间房间,而走廊只有一张桌子的宽度。搬一次需要10分钟。输入 几 组数据,房间编号 m 到 n ,求最少需要多少分钟。样例:Sample Input3 4 10 20 30 40 50 60 70 80 2 1 3 2 200 3 10 100 20 80 30 50 Sample

2016-03-15 18:49:41 175

原创 2016SDAU课程练习一1004

简单题意:有很多电视节目,已知转播时间表,合理安排,以看更多的电视节目。输入n,有n行数据,表示每个节目的起始时间和终止时间。输出最多能看的电视节目数。样例:121 33 40 73 815 1915 2010 158 186 125 104 142 90解题思路形成过程:读完题意意识到这是贪心算法实现的。将每个电视节目的起始

2016-03-14 17:52:27 202

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除